mfc動態新增

mfc下滑鼠拖動畫面使檢視移動的實現方法,類似瀏覽PDF時用手型滑鼠移動檢視的效果

1.在滑鼠按下事件中記錄當前滑鼠位置和滾動條當前位置 2.在滑鼠移動事件中動態修改滾動條位置,並使用雙緩衝貼圖的方法實現無閃爍重新整理畫面 具體程式碼如下   void OnRButtonDown(UINT nFlags, CPoint point) { //這兩個是全域性變數,型別是Cpoint […]

MFC 實現圖片的拖拽功能,程式碼很詳細,貼過去就能用!

拖動是介面程式設計頻繁使用的一個效果,在windows系統下可謂大行其道。縱觀時下的應用軟體幾乎各個都支援各種各樣拖動的效果,windows7更是把拖動做到了極致。其實說起來拖動的實現也很簡單,對於有控制代碼的物件都可以通過MoveWindow或SetWindowPos實現位置變動,而沒有控制代碼的 […]

MFC DLL的一些知識

 雖然能用DLL實現的東西都可以用COM來實現,但DLL的優點確實不少,它更容易建立。本文將討論如何利用MFC來建立不同型別的DLL,以及如何使用他們。 一、DLL的不同型別    使用MFC可以生成兩種型別的DLL:MFC擴充套件DLL和常規DLL。常規DLL有可以分為動態連線和靜態連線。Visu […]

在MFC中呼叫LabView生成的DLL

首先開啟LabView,新建一個工程,再新建一個VI,這裡就做簡單,實現加法功能即可。程式框圖如下: 在前面板上,需要標出VI的輸入和輸出,即在下圖的右上角的連線板,很簡單,先滑鼠左鍵輸入X,再點一下連線板上左邊,輸入Y同理。滑鼠左鍵點sum, 再在連線板上右邊點一下,最後就可以看見連線板上有3個方 […]